Abstract
The utility model discloses a kind of new hydrology measurement apparatus, including the vertical rod for being fixed on monitored river, river course side, the upper end of vertical rod is additionally provided with workbench, instrument container is installed on workbench, it is also equipped with extending to river course, the probe arm above river on workbench, support bar is additionally provided between probe arm and vertical rod, suspending rod is further fixed on workbench, the both ends of probe arm are connected by the upper end of steel wire pull line and suspending rod respectively;The end of probe arm is hung with measurement support, and measurement support is provided with current meter and indicator water gage.The utility model sets probe arm and suspending rod, the both ends of probe arm to be fixed by the upper end of steel wire pull line and suspending rod by setting workbench in vertical rod, in workbench, so that probe arm is fixed reliably;The level measurement device is simple in construction, selects the length of vertical rod and probe arm to meet that different fields sets up needs as needed, erection construction is simply, conveniently.

Embodiment
Describe the utility model in detail below with reference to accompanying drawing and in conjunction with the embodiments.It should be noted that do not rushing
In the case of prominent, the feature in embodiment and embodiment in the utility model can be mutually combined.
In one embodiment of new hydrology measurement apparatus of the present utility model as shown in Figure 1 to Figure 2, the new hydrology
Measurement apparatus is used for the vertical rod 10 for being fixed on monitored river, river course side, and the upper end of vertical rod 10 is additionally provided with workbench 20, work
Make that instrument container 21 is installed on platform, be also equipped with extending to river course, the probe arm 30 above river on workbench 20, visit
Support bar 31 is additionally provided between head support arm 30 and vertical rod 10, suspending rod 40 is further fixed on workbench 20, probe arm 30
Both ends are connected by steel wire pull line 41 with the upper end of suspending rod 40 respectively;The end of probe arm 30 is hung with measurement support 50,
Measurement support 50 includes the vertical hanger 51 being connected with probe arm 30 and the horizontal hanger 52 for being fixed on the vertical lower end of hanger 51,
Current meter 53 is installed on vertical hanger 51, indicator water gage 54, current meter 53, indicator water gage are installed on horizontal hanger 52
54 are connected with instrument container 21.New hydrology measurement apparatus in the embodiment, by setting workbench in vertical rod, in work
Making platform sets probe arm and suspending rod, the both ends of probe arm to be fixed by the upper end of steel wire pull line and suspending rod, thus
So that probe arm is fixed reliably;The end of probe arm is fixed with the current meter and indicator water gage being connected with instrument container, stream
Fast instrument and indicator water gage are separately fixed on vertical hanger and horizontal hanger, and the two thus can be avoided to interfere and cause to do
Disturb, Position Design is reasonable;The level measurement device is simple in construction, selects the length of vertical rod and probe arm to expire as needed
The different field of foot, which is set up, to be needed, and erection construction is simply, conveniently.Specifically, by the way that current meter and indicator water gage are distinguished
It is fixedly mounted, current meter is fixed on vertical hanger and probe has 30 ° to 60 ° of angle down and with vertical direction, thus
The monitoring to water velocity is realized, indicator water gage is fixed on horizontal hanger and popped one's head in and water surface elevation is supervised downwards
Survey, so that two monitoring components will not be produced and interfered.
In the above-described embodiments, new hydrology measurement apparatus also has following technical characteristic:The upper end of suspending rod 40 is also solid
Surely there is lightning rod 42, thunderbolt thus can be avoided to ensure the safe to use of the hydrographic survey device.Also install at the middle part of suspending rod 40
There is the photovoltaic solar cell plate 43 being connected with instrument container 21, specifically, in instrument container be additionally provided with accumulators store photovoltaic too
It is positive can the electric energy that gathers of cell panel 43, provide electric energy for current meter and indicator water gage, thus without by power network to the water
Literary measurement apparatus power supply, the needs of field monitoring can be met by being not required to stringing power supply, easy to use.The surrounding of workbench 20 is also
Guardrail 22 provided with lattice-shaped, is thus easy to staff to be overhauled, detected to instrument container, ensures the person peace of staff
Entirely.The upper end of vertical rod 10 is provided with the mounting flange 11 for stationary work-table 20, and bolt coordinates workbench with mounting flange 11
20 are fixed in vertical rod 10;The both ends of support bar 31 are fixedly linked by bolt and vertical rod 10, probe arm 30 respectively, thus,
Each connecting portion can quickly realize that installation is fixed by using bolted mode, and construction is set up simply, conveniently.Measurement branch
The top and both sides of frame 50 are also equipped with protective cover 55, thus can realize the protection to current meter, indicator water gage, avoid day
Shine, drench with rain, it is reliability and service life to improve the hydrographic survey device.
